Overview

The Smith & Wesson 1854 is a rifle chambered in .44 Magnum, a caliber known for its use in both handguns and lever-action rifles. This model features a barrel length of 19.25 inches, which is typical for rifles designed for handling and mobility while maintaining sufficient sight radius and velocity for the cartridge. It offers a standard capacity of 9 rounds, providing a reasonable payload for a lever-action or similarly styled rifle platform. The combination of caliber, barrel length, and capacity positions the 1854 as a rifle suited for shooters interested in .44 Magnum ballistics in a rifle-length platform.
